HRT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2023 in Review

81 of the 6,275 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in HireRight Holdings Corporation (HRT) for Q1 2023, worth a combined $718M — down 11% from $807M a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 18 funds opened new HRT positions and 9 closed out — a net gain of 9 holders — while 29 added to existing stakes and 23 trimmed.

The largest buyer was LGT Capital Partners, opening a new position worth an estimated $6.58M. The largest seller was Indaba Capital Management, cutting an estimated $11M.
